Classic Book Cafe Wall Design & Polyurethane Panels
Classic book cafe wall design is a specialized polyurethane decoration application used behind bookshelves or in reading areas to create a traditional library atmosphere in hybrid book-and-cafe spaces. The primary goal of this style is to establish wood-like or classic painted wall surfaces that foster a quiet, peaceful, and inviting environment. Polyurethane decorative elements are far more lightweight and economical than authentic wood panels, ensuring rapid installation that speeds up the opening process. Furthermore, they show high resistance to impacts and the friction of book shelves, preventing surface wear. Since polyurethane is impervious to moisture, it maintains a dry wall environment that helps protect books from mold and dampness. If desired, these profiles can be finished with distressed wood stains or custom paints. Due to its high-density foam structure, this material also contributes to acoustic comfort by absorbing minor ambient sounds, making it ideal for reading zones and cozy study corners.

Frequently Asked Questions
Which polyurethane elements are used in classic book cafe wall design?
Classic wall moldings, pilaster column capitals, and wood-textured polyurethane panels are commonly used.
What is the advantage of using polyurethane in book cafes?
It is easy to clean, impact-resistant, quickly installed, and offers an authentic wood look economically.
